Book Summary
In Dear John, a poignant wartime romance about duty, love, and the choices that test a relationship, the early 2000s setting follows John, a young Army recruit, and Savannah whose bond is challenged by distance and the upheaval of 9/11. This novel is ideal for adult readers who crave heartfelt, character-driven stories with emotional depth, offering a hopeful and intimate reading experience.
Written in warm, accessible prose, Dear John unfolds through John’s life—his Army days, his moments with Savannah, and the long shadow of 9/11. The narrative blends memories with present-day longing, creating a heartfelt, character-driven journey that feels intimate and real.
What makes the reading experience special is the way the book balances romance with history and personal growth. The storytelling emphasizes endurance, trust, and the choices that come with distance, with a thoughtful pace that invites reflection as the setting—small towns, bases, and the early 2000s—comes vividly to life.
After finishing Dear John, readers carry a sense of how love can endure across miles and time, leaving them with hope, empathy, and a deeper appreciation for those who choose truth over easy paths.

Nicholas Sparks Is The Author Of Twenty-Five Books, Including Counting Miracles And Dreamland, All Of Which Have Been New York Times Bestsellers. His Books Have Been Published Across More Than Fifty Languages With Over 150 Million Copies Sold Worldwide, And Eleven Have Been Adapted Into Films. He Is Also The Founder Of The Nicholas Sparks Foundation, A Nonprofit Committed To Improving Cultural And International Understanding Through Global Education Experiences. He Lives In North Carolina.
